
http://bugzilla.novell.com/show_bug.cgi?id=547926 Summary: YAST 2 Software update insists on changing bundle-lang package Classification: openSUSE Product: openSUSE 11.2 Version: RC 1 Platform: x86-64 OS/Version: openSUSE 11.2 Status: NEW Severity: Normal Priority: P5 - None Component: YaST2 AssignedTo: bnc-team-screening@forge.provo.novell.com ReportedBy: colin.pendred@gmail.com QAContact: jsrain@novell.com Found By: --- User-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(X11; U; Linux x86_64; en-GB; rv:1.9.1.3) Gecko/20090909 SUSE/3.5.3-3.2 Firefox/3.5.3 When using YAST2 software update and selecting "All packages -> Update if newer version available" a different version of the bundle-lang-kde package is chosen. It is not possible to deselect it without Yast automatically selecting a different version. It goes through the packages sequentially until it gets to bundle-lang-kde-zh, at which point it won't let you deselect it. I normally have bundle-lang-kde-en selected as my native language. This behaviour is not seen when using zypper up from the command line. Re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ce: 1. Open YAST2 Package Manager 2. Select All Packages -> Update if newer version available 3.
